http://www.nba.com/hawks/al-horford-named-nba-eastern-conference-player-week

 

In winning the honor for the second time in his career, Horford led the Hawks to a perfect 3-0 week (road wins over Cleveland and Houston, and a home win over Chicago), averaging 18.3 points, 6.7 rebounds, 5.0 assists, 1.7 blocks and 1.0 steals in 32.0 minutes (.605 FG%, .750 FT%). He was the only player in the NBA to average at least 18.0 points, 6.0 rebounds, 5.0 assists, 1.0 blocks and 1.0 steals, and shoot at least .600 FG% for the week. Including the three-game winning streak, Atlanta has won 12-of-13.

In the 12/15 contest against Chicago, he recorded a double-double of 21 points and 10 rebounds to go along with a season-high six assists and two steals in 33 minutes (10-19 FGs). He followed that up with a 20-point night at Cleveland (10-14 FGs) in 31 minutes and 14 points, eight rebounds, five assists, three blocks and a steal in 32 minutes at Houston. He set or tied season-highs in assists, defensive rebounds and blocks during the week.

Horford helped Atlanta to lead the NBA in FG% (.528), apg (29.3) and assist/turnover ratio (2.59) last week, while ranking first in the East (second in the NBA) in ppg (108.0). On the season, he ranks 12th in the NBA in FG%, t13th in bpg and t26th in FGM (170) in 29.8 mpg.
